Transaction 166e1ac8e50bcb132f845c7f68cfb02b2659c7d33a23c85977891afb02b58bfd
1 Input
1 Output
-
166e1ac8e50bcb132f845c7f68cfb02b2659c7d33a23c85977891afb02b58bfd:0
- value
- 151678438
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44d104b9d2613e7da193ca4a9193fc8bdc6f63b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 17GsLuJKgmT5pZqfF7WLZ6d82ZMXUjDU3r